What 'industry standard' actually means

Most trade contractors don't shop for a website often enough to know what's normal. Here's what the research on competing agencies actually turned up: $5,000-$15,000+ for a custom build, multi-week timelines built around discovery calls and revision cycles, and structured data (the technical markup that helps you get found and cited by AI answer engines) treated as an optional upsell, if it's mentioned at all.

The comparison

Price: industry standard is $5,000-$15,000+, often with an ongoing SEO retainer on top. Agency Logics is $1,500-$2,500 flat, no hidden retainer required to see the structured-data work land.

Timeline: industry standard is weeks to months, built around scheduled discovery calls. Agency Logics is 48 hours from purchase, because the information a discovery call collects gets gathered upfront instead.

Structured data and GEO formatting: industry standard treats this as optional or doesn't offer it. Every Agency Logics build includes it from page one, see our process page for what that actually involves.

Systems integration: industry standard typically hands you a website and leaves the CRM and AI tooling as a separate purchase from a separate vendor, if it's mentioned at all. Agency Logics builds the website, CRM, and AI assistant to work as one connected system.

Why the price is lower and the delivery is faster

Not because less work goes in. Because the process is built specifically for trade and service businesses instead of re-invented from scratch for every client, the same reason a specialist is often faster than a generalist. The technical depth (structured data, content architecture, connected systems) doesn't get cut to hit the price or the timeline, it's built into the system from the start.
